Double-spin asymmetries in the cross section of electroproduction of $ρ^0$ and $ϕ$ mesons on the proton and deuteron are measured at the HERMES experiment. The photoabsorption asymmetry in exclusive $ρ^0$ electroproduction on the proton exhibits a positive tendency. This is consistent with theoretical predictions that the exchange of an object with unnatural parity contributes to exclusive $ρ^0$ electroproduction by transverse photons. The photoabsorption asymmetry on the deuteron is found to be consistent with zero. Double-spin asymmetries in $ρ^0$ and $ϕ$ meson electroproduction by quasi-real photons were also found to be consistent with zero; the asymmetry in the case of the $ϕ$ meson is compatible with a theoretical prediction which involves $s\bar{s}$ knockout from the nucleon.
